Ye also helping together by prayer for us, that for the gift bestowed upon us by the means of many persons thanks may be given by many on our behalf.

Bible References

Helping

2 Corinthians 9:14
And by their prayer for you, who long after you, for the exceeding grace of God, which is in you.
Acts 12:5
So Peter was kept in the prison; but continual prayer was made to God by the church for him.
Romans 15:30
Now I beseech you, brethren, by our Lord Jesus Christ, and by the love of the Spirit, to strive together with me,
Ephesians 6:18
which is the word of God, Praying alway by the Spirit with all prayer and supplication, and watching thereunto with all perseverance and supplication for all the saints,
Philippians 1:19
For I know that this shall turn to my salvation, through your prayer, and the supply of the Spirit of Jesus Christ:
Colossians 4:3
Withal, praying likewise for us, that God would open to us a door of utterance, to speak the mystery of Christ: for which I am also in bonds:
1 Thessalonians 5:25
Brethren, pray for us.
2 Thessalonians 3:1
Finally, brethren, pray for us, that the word of the Lord may run and be glorified, even as among you:
Philemon 1:22
Withal prepare me also a lodging; for I trust I shall be given to you through your prayers.
Hebrews 13:18
Pray for us; for we trust we have a good conscience, desiring to behave ourselves well in all things.
James 5:16
Confess your faults one to another, brethren, and pray one for another, that ye may be healed: the fervent prayer of a righteous man availeth much.
